Combustible ice heralds clean energy
By Zheng Xin and Zou Shuo | China Daily | Updated: 2017-09-04 07:43
China gains edge for commercial production after sustained trials
China's success in mining gas hydrate in the South China Sea is a breakthrough that could revolutionize the global energy industry, and prove more significant than the United States' shale gas, experts said.
The gas hydrate, commonly known as combustible ice, is perhaps another 15 years away from commercial use, but its successful mining in China is a breakthrough nevertheless, said Lu Hailong, a professor at the Institute of Ocean Research, which is part of Peking University.
